Jen McConnaughhay, MSW
Jennifer McConnaughhay moved to Florida from Virginia to complete her college education. She earned a Bachelor's in Social Work in 2006 and her Master's in Social Work in 2007 from Florida State University. She has worked with the elderly since prior to college. She loves the career path she has chosen and views her work as a privilege. "Our seniors are so important and yet often times they are the forgotten population." Jennifer discovered her passion when she lived with her grandparents for two years. Before joining Senior Transitions she served as the social service director at a long-term care facility. She has also worked and volunteered for hospice. Jennifer is very familiar with local resources available to seniors. This is through experience with case management and discharge planning at a rehabilitation hospital. Jennifer is married to Allen and they have one daughter, Emma Kate and another girl on the way.
As a member of the Senior Transitions team, Jennifer provides case management to elders and their families at home or in facilities. She works closely with health care professionals to ensure that their loved ones receive optimal care. Jennifer attends care plan meetings and appointments with patients and family members. She visits patients weekly and updates families of any changes.
